What Are GLP-1 Receptor Agonists?
GLP-1 is a hormonal agent naturally produced in the intestines. It plays a vital function [GLP-1-Rezepte in Deutschland](https://md.swk-web.com/s/tRS24lnuB) managing blood sugar levels and hunger. GLP-1 receptor agonists are artificial versions of this hormone that remain in the body considerably longer than the natural variation.

These medications work through three primary systems:
Insulin Secretion: They promote the pancreas to launch insulin when blood sugar levels are high.Glucagon Suppression: They prevent the liver from releasing excessive sugar.Stomach Emptying: They slow down the rate at which food leaves the stomach, resulting in a prolonged sensation of fullness.Hunger Regulation: They act on the brain's "cravings center" to minimize food yearnings and increase satiety.Available GLP-1 Medications in Germany
The German pharmaceutical market, governed by the Federal Institute for Drugs and Medical Devices (BfArM), provides a number of GLP-1 and dual-agonist medications. While some are strictly for diabetes, others have received particular approval for obesity treatment.
Table 1: Common GLP-1 and Related Medications in the German MarketBrandActive IngredientFrequencyMain Indication (Germany)OzempicSemaglutideWeekly InjectionType 2 DiabetesWegovySemaglutideWeekly InjectionObesity/ Weight ManagementMounjaroTirzepatide *Weekly InjectionType 2 Diabetes & & ObesityVictozaLiraglutideDaily InjectionType 2 DiabetesSaxendaLiraglutideDaily InjectionObesity/ Weight ManagementRybelsusSemaglutideDaily Oral PillType 2 DiabetesTrulicityDulaglutideWeekly InjectionType 2 Diabetes
* Tirzepatide is a double GIP and [GLP-1 online in Deutschland kaufen](https://pad.stuve.de/s/BH1yhj526) receptor agonist, frequently classified with GLP-1s due to similar results.
The Regulatory Framework in Germany
The distribution of GLP-1 [GLP1 Injections Germany](https://wristtarget8.werite.net/why-we-enjoy-glp1-purchase-germany-and-you-should-too) in Germany is strictly regulated. Unlike some other jurisdictions where "medical health clubs" might provide these treatments with very little oversight, Germany needs a doctor's prescription for all GLP-1 medications.
Prescription Categories
In Germany, a distinction is made between treatment for a medical condition (Type 2 Diabetes) and "way of life" or preventive treatment (Weight Loss).
Type 2 Diabetes: Patients diagnosed with Type 2 Diabetes are qualified for these medications under the assistance of a family doctor or endocrinologist.Weight Problems (Adipositas): For weight reduction, medications like Wegovy and Saxenda are authorized for patients with a BMI over 30, or a BMI over 27 with at least one weight-related comorbidity (e.g., high blood pressure).The "Lifestyle-Arzneimittel" Challenge
Under Section 34 of the Social Code Book V (SGB V), the German federal government categorizes particular drugs as "way of life" medications. Historically, weight loss drugs have fallen under this classification, indicating that statutory medical insurance providers (Gesetzliche Krankenversicherung - GKV) are typically prohibited from covering them, even if a medical professional deems them medically required.
Insurance Coverage and Costs
The cost of GLP-1 injections in Germany depends heavily on the patient's insurance coverage status and the particular diagnosis.
Statutory Health Insurance (GKV)
For patients with Type 2 Diabetes, GKV companies (such as TK, AOK, or Barmer) typically cover the costs of medications like Ozempic or Trulicity. The patient typically just pays a small co-payment (Zuzahlung) of EUR5 to EUR10. However, GKV presently does not cover medications prescribed entirely for weight loss (like Wegovy), despite the seriousness of the obesity.
Private Health Insurance (PKV)
Private insurance providers in Germany are often more flexible. Some PKV service providers cover Wegovy or Saxenda if the doctor provides a detailed validation demonstrating that the weight loss is medically required to prevent more complications like heart disease or joint failure.
Out-of-Pocket Costs (Selbstzahler)
For those paying out-of-pocket, the expenses can be substantial:
Wegovy: Depending on the dosage, regular monthly expenses can vary from EUR170 to over EUR300.Saxenda: Approximately EUR290 monthly.Ozempic (if recommended off-label): Roughly EUR80 to EUR100 for a month's supply, though off-label prescribing for weight reduction is presently discouraged in Germany due to shortages.Supply Shortages and BfArM Guidance
Germany, [kosten für Eine Glp-1-therapie in deutschland](https://md.swk-web.com/s/j3Bt6O7UJ) like the remainder of the world, has actually faced substantial supply shortages of GLP-1 medications, especially Ozempic. Due to the fact that Ozempic was often recommended "off-label" for weight reduction, supply for diabetic patients became stretched.

In reaction, the BfArM issued numerous suggestions:
Prioritization: Physicians are urged to focus on diabetic patients for Ozempic.Export Bans: To make sure domestic supply, Germany has actually occasionally implemented restrictions on exporting these medications to other nations.Strict Documentation: Pharmacies are under increased scrutiny to ensure that prescriptions for Ozempic are for diabetes patients just.The Process: How to Get GLP-1 Injections in Germany
The German medical system stresses safety and long-term monitoring. The typical pathway for a patient consists of numerous actions:
Initial Consultation: A client consults with their GP or an endocrinologist to talk about weight or blood sugar level issues.Diagnostic Testing: Blood work is needed to check HbA1c levels, kidney function, and thyroid health.Prescription Issuance: If eligible, the physician issues a prescription. This can be a "Pink Note" (Kassenrezept) for GKV-covered diabetes treatment, a "Blue Note" (Privatrezept) for self-payers or private clients, or an E-Rezept (Electronic Prescription).Drug store Fulfillment: The patient takes the prescription to a regional Apotheke. If the drug runs out stock, the pharmacy can frequently order it through a wholesaler, though wait times might apply.Follow-up Visits: German physicians usually need check-ups every 3 to 6 months to keep an eye on negative effects and adjust does.Safety and Side Effects

Is Wegovy offered in Germany?
Yes, Wegovy was formally introduced in Germany in mid-2023. It is readily available for adult clients with a BMI of 30+ or 27+ with comorbidities.
2. Can I get Ozempic for weight loss in Germany?
While Ozempic includes semaglutide (the very same ingredient as Wegovy), its authorized indication [GLP-1-Lieferoptionen in Deutschland](https://pad.stuve.de/s/gpO_g7DpX) Germany is for Type 2 Diabetes. Due to shortages, BfArM strongly dissuades its use for weight reduction to make sure diabetic clients have access. Wegovy is the appropriate alternative for weight management.
3. Does the Krankenkasse (GKV) spend for weight reduction injections?
Generally, no. Statutory insurance thinks about these "way of life" drugs. Nevertheless, if the patient has Type 2 Diabetes, the insurance will cover the GLP-1 medication prescribed for that condition.
4. Can I buy GLP-1 injections online in Germany?
Lawfully, you can only get these medications from a licensed pharmacy with a legitimate prescription. Be wary of websites offering these drugs without a prescription, as they are typically counterfeit and hazardous.
5. What happens if I stop taking the injection?
Studies show that lots of patients gain back weight after stopping GLP-1 treatment if lifestyle changes (diet plan and workout) are not maintained. German medical professionals usually suggest a long-lasting prepare for tapering or upkeep.
6. Are there oral alternatives to injections?
Yes, Rybelsus is an oral tablet kind of Semaglutide readily available in Germany, mainly suggested for Type 2 Diabetes.
